diff options
author | Johannes Linke <johannes.linke@posteo.de> | 2015-09-10 20:37:23 +0200 |
---|---|---|
committer | Johannes Linke <johannes.linke@posteo.de> | 2015-09-10 20:57:09 +0200 |
commit | 0c59d1be254a44b91bb9c8243289a8f1e7a6e242 (patch) | |
tree | b274f3cb4ab182d2a92894b797787b67c514dca9 /compressor/filters | |
parent | 7b1e4428320f9b1324331fad086adbf546005b54 (diff) | |
download | django-compressor-0c59d1be254a44b91bb9c8243289a8f1e7a6e242.tar.gz |
CachedCompilerFilter: also cache empty files
Diffstat (limited to 'compressor/filters')
-rw-r--r-- | compressor/filters/base.py |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/compressor/filters/base.py b/compressor/filters/base.py index f61f3a4..95eed1d 100644 --- a/compressor/filters/base.py +++ b/compressor/filters/base.py @@ -224,7 +224,7 @@ class CachedCompilerFilter(CompilerFilter): if self.mimetype in settings.COMPRESS_CACHEABLE_PRECOMPILERS: key = self.get_cache_key() data = cache.get(key) - if data: + if data is not None: return data filtered = super(CachedCompilerFilter, self).input(**kwargs) cache.set(key, filtered, settings.COMPRESS_REBUILD_TIMEOUT) |